Some Elmbrook School Board Members Question Early Release

Elmbrook's 2012-13 school calendar scheduled for a board vote Dec. 13 includes continued early release Thursdays.

Parents who would like the Elmbrook School District to end its policy of releasing students early on Thursdays for staff development will likely have to keep it on their wish list.

Early release Thursdays are poised to continue for the 2012-'13 school year, under a proposed calendar scheduled for vote by the School Board Dec. 13.

Some board members, however, have asked whether there would be a better way to schedule staff development that would be easier for working parents to handle.

At recent board and committee meetings, board members Glen Allgaier and Meg Wartman said they believed parents would prefer to have the same release time every day.

"Parents would be a lot happier," Allgaier said at a Personnel Committee meeting.

Allgaier questioned whether it would make more sense to release students the same time every day, but 15 minutes earlier than currently scheduled.

Principals say a longer block of time is needed — about two hours are available on Thursdays for teachers and administrators to discuss instructional ideas, standardized test data and other curricular issues.

"It's valued by staff and administrators," Principal Robyn Martino said.

The proposed 2012-13 school calendar does not change the Thursday early release times, which are:

  • 2:46 p.m. for elementary schools (3:43 p.m. release other days)
  • 1:34 p.m. for middle schools (2:31 p.m.)
  • 2:12 p.m. for high schools (3:09 p.m.)
  • 2:02 p.m. for Fairview South special education school (2:59 p.m.)

Other items of note in the calendar:

  • The first day of school would be Tuesday, Sept. 4, 2012.
  • No teachers convention expected but Friday, Oct. 26, 2012 would be a day off "to break up the quarter."
  • Thanksgiving break would be Wednesday, Nov. 21, 2012 through Friday, Nov. 23.
  • Holiday break would be Monday, Dec. 24, 2012 through Wednesday, Jan. 2, 2103, with classes resuming Thursday, Jan. 3.
  • Spring break would be Friday, March 29, 2013 through Friday, April 5, 2013.
  • Last day of school would be June 11, 2013.
